Meaning of Ortha:
Ortha is a feminine given name of Greek origin. It is derived from the Greek word 'orthos', which means 'straight' or 'upright'. Ortha represents strength, resilience, and integrity. It signifies a person who stands firm in their values and beliefs. Choosing Ortha for your daughter shows a desire for her to embody principles of honesty and authenticity.
